diff options
author | Anton Babushkin <anton.babushkin@me.com> | 2014-06-27 00:29:00 +0200 |
---|---|---|
committer | Anton Babushkin <anton.babushkin@me.com> | 2014-06-27 00:29:00 +0200 |
commit | 1bae18377a444279f91b75281ffde5da70cc6086 (patch) | |
tree | 797b1318b9500883f08a9f2905a9318a4a4489d3 | |
parent | 9ae44291b169a90945f090487e3757db9fc8c075 (diff) | |
download | px4-firmware-1bae18377a444279f91b75281ffde5da70cc6086.tar.gz px4-firmware-1bae18377a444279f91b75281ffde5da70cc6086.tar.bz2 px4-firmware-1bae18377a444279f91b75281ffde5da70cc6086.zip |
navigator: is_mission_item_reached() for LOITER items fixed
-rw-r--r-- | src/modules/navigator/mission_block.cpp | 9 |
1 files changed, 2 insertions, 7 deletions
diff --git a/src/modules/navigator/mission_block.cpp b/src/modules/navigator/mission_block.cpp index 5e545706d..8ef7be449 100644 --- a/src/modules/navigator/mission_block.cpp +++ b/src/modules/navigator/mission_block.cpp @@ -74,15 +74,10 @@ MissionBlock::is_mission_item_reached() } /* TODO: count turns */ -#if 0 - if ((_mission_item.nav_cmd == NAV_CMD_LOITER_TURN_COUNT || - _mission_item.nav_cmd == NAV_CMD_LOITER_TIME_LIMIT || - _mission_item.nav_cmd == NAV_CMD_LOITER_UNLIMITED) && - _mission_item.loiter_radius > 0.01f) { - + if ((/*_mission_item.nav_cmd == NAV_CMD_LOITER_TURN_COUNT ||*/ + _mission_item.nav_cmd == NAV_CMD_LOITER_UNLIMITED)) { return false; } -#endif hrt_abstime now = hrt_absolute_time(); |